Day 2: Propose Day – The Day to Pop the Question
If you’ve been thinking about taking your relationship to the next level, Propose Day on February 8th is the day to do it. Whether you’re planning an extravagant proposal or a simple, intimate moment, this day is meant to solidify your love with a promise.

Day 3: Chocolate Day – Sweeten the Deal
Chocolate Day falls on February 9th and is the perfect excuse to indulge in sweet treats with your significant other. Valentine’s Day chocolates are an essential gift for this day, making it a wonderful time to pamper your partner.

Day 4: Teddy Day – A Day for Cuddles
Teddy Day is all about cuddling up and showing affection through adorable stuffed animals. It’s a cozy, intimate day to let your partner know how much they mean to you.

Day 5: Promise Day – Making a Promise of Love
On Promise Day, couples exchange promises of commitment, love, and trust. It’s the perfect day to give your loved one a promise that you will cherish forever.
